Product overviewAV4958 multifunctional microwave analyzer integrates multiple functions like testingof cable and antenna VSWR, distance to fault (DTF), insertion loss and gain, spectrum analysis and power measurement, etc. It is flexible and convenient to carry. Battery is available for power supply so it is suitable for field testing. Used widely in several fields including field installation and tuning of electronic equipment in terms ofradar, communication and ECM, performance test, daily maintenance and emergent repair and test, the analyzer can help upgrade filed repair and support of users.Main Features1. Multiple measurement modes: Antenna feeder test: for test of cable and antenna (return loss, DTF,etc.)Network analysis: for test of full S-parameters (various display types);
Spectrum analysis: for spectrum analysis (field strength, channel power, occupied bandwidth, etc.);
Power monitoring: for power measurement;
Vector voltage measurement: for measurement of vector voltage;
USB power measurement: for power measurement of USB interface;
2. High performance
Frequency range of feeder test is 1MHz~20GHz, frequency resolution is 10Hz;
Frequency range of network analysis is 1MHz~20GHz, frequency resolution is 10Hz, dynamic range is 80dB~95dB;
Frequency range of spectrum analysis is 100KHz~20GHzm,sideband noise is -105dBc/Hz@1MHz (1GHz carrier);
3. Flexibility
Small and light with built-in battery, provideseasy field operation;
Perfect auto diagnosis and auto status testing;
Intelligent power management, indication of remaining capacity and lower battery warning;
4. Friendly man-analyzer interface: Chinese and English menuwith instructions and help info;
7-inch high-brightness true-color TFT LCD, good visibility even under direct sunlight
5. Universal interface
External input bias T is available, provides supply for active DUT;
Two types of USB2.0 interface, for connection of portable storage device and communication with PC;
One 100M network interface, for construction of local network or remote control

Items | Specifications | ||
Test of antenna and transmission lines | Frequency range | 1MHz~20GHz | |
Frequency accuracy | ±1×10-6 | ||
Frequency resolution | 10Hz | ||
Data points | 11,21,51,101,201,501,1001 | ||
Effective directivity | 32dB~42dB | ||
Effective source match | 30dB | ||
Network analysis | Frequency range | 1MHz~20GHz | |
Frequency accuracy | ±1×10-6 | ||
Frequency resolution | 10Hz | ||
Data points | 11,21,51,101,201,501,1001 | ||
IF bandwidth | 10Hz~100kHz, in 1-2-10 sequence | ||
Effective directivity | 32dB~42dB | ||
Effective source match | 30dB | ||
S21 Dynamic range | 80dB~95dB | ||
Spectrum Analysis |
Frequency range | 100kHz~20GHz(can be modulated to 9kHz) | |
Harmonic resolution | 1Hz | ||
Sweep width | 100Hz~20GHz,0Hz | ||
Resolution bandwidth | 1Hz~3MHz, in 1-3-10 sequence | ||
Video bandwidth | 1Hz~3MHzn, in 1-3-10 sequence | ||
Noise sideband | ≤-97dBc/Hz@10kHz(CF=1GHz) ≤-98dBc/Hz@100kHz(CF=1GHz) ≤-105dBc/Hz@1MHz(CF=1GHz) |
||
Displayed average noise level | ≤-151dBm/Hz(10MHz~4GHz,preamplifier is on) ≤-133dBm/Hz(10MHz~8GHz) ≤-123dBm/Hz(8GHz~20GHz) |
||
Total absolute amplitude accuracy | ±2.0dB(20℃~30℃,input 0dBm~-50dBm) ±2.7dB(0℃~50℃,input 0dBm~-50dBm) |
||
Residual response | ≤-80dBm | ||
Reference level range | -80dBm~+30dBm | ||
Input voltage VSWR | ≤1.7:1(≤6GHz,typical value) ≤2.1:1(>6GHz,typical value) |
||
Power measurement (option) |
Frequency range | 10MHz~18GHz(depending on the sensor) | |
Power range | -50dBm~+20dBm | ||
Power accuracy | ±1.5dB | ||
Frequency measurement | Frequency range | 100kHz~20GHz | |
Frequency resolution | 1Hz | ||
Frequency accuracy | ±[readout frequency×(1×10-6(23℃)+10-6/10℃)+10Hz] | ||
Sensitivity | -40dBm | ||
Interface | Test interface of cable and antenna feeder | Type N(F) | |
Test interface of VNA | Type N(F) | ||
Test interface of spectrum analysis | Type N(F) | ||
Control interface | USB, LAN | ||
Operating temp | 0℃~+50℃ | ||
Storage temp | -40℃~ +70℃ | ||
Dimensions | Max dimensions:330mm(W)×230mm(H)×120mm(D) | ||
Weight | Less than 5kg | ||
Supply | AC | 220V~ ±10%,50Hz±5% | |
Built-in battery | Nominal voltage: 10.8V,consecutive working time≥3h | ||
Power consumption | ≤28W | ||
Cooling method | Internal air cooling |
